QIB Sukuk Ltd Bonds

QIB Sukuk Ltd, founded in 2007 and based in Doha, Qatar, is a leading Islamic finance institution dedicated to providing Sharia-compliant investment opportunities. The company primarily focuses on issuing Sukuk, which are Sharia-compliant bonds, contributing to the growth of the Islamic finance market in the region.
